The Breakdown 12

  • The Seattle Mariners celebrated baseball legend Ichiro Suzuki by unveiling a statue at T-Mobile Park, capturing his iconic batting stance as a tribute to his remarkable career.
  • The ceremony, held on April 10, 2026, drew fans and media attention, marking a significant moment in the sports community.
  • In a twist of fate, the unveiling went awry when the statue’s bronze bat broke during the reveal, leading to an unexpected and comical mishap.
  • Ichiro lightheartedly joked about the situation, playfully blaming Yankees closer Mariano Rivera for the trouble, referencing Rivera's notorious cutter that famously shattered bats.
  • Despite the setback, the event maintained a celebratory atmosphere, showcasing Ichiro's enduring legacy and connection to the Mariners and their fans.
  • The incident highlighted not only the excitement of the statue reveal but also the humor and camaraderie integral to baseball culture.

What materials are used for sports statues?

Sports statues are commonly made from materials like bronze, marble, or fiberglass. Bronze is favored for its durability and ability to capture fine details, making it ideal for lifelike representations. Marble offers an elegant aesthetic but is more fragile. Fiberglass is lightweight and can be molded into various shapes, though it may lack the same timeless quality as metal or stone. The choice of material often reflects the intended permanence and visual impact of the statue, as seen in many iconic sports tributes.

What is the significance of T-Mobile Park?

T-Mobile Park, located in Seattle, is the home of the Seattle Mariners and serves as a prominent venue for Major League Baseball. Opened in 1999, it is known for its retractable roof and scenic views of the Seattle skyline and waterfront. The park has hosted numerous memorable events, including All-Star Games and playoff games. It symbolizes the Mariners' connection to the community and is a focal point for baseball fans in the region, making it an ideal location for honoring legends like Ichiro Suzuki.

How do artists create sports sculptures?

Artists create sports sculptures through a meticulous process that begins with research and conceptualization, often involving sketches and models. They typically use materials like clay or wax for initial prototypes, allowing for adjustments before finalizing the design. Once approved, artists cast the sculpture in bronze or shape it in stone, paying close attention to detail to capture the athlete's likeness and spirit. The process can take months or years, blending artistic skill with an understanding of the athlete's significance in sports history.
